# Copyright 2023 Oliver Smith # SPDX-License-Identifier: GPL-3.0-or-later from pmb.helpers import logging import pmb.chroot import pmb.chroot.apk import pmb.helpers.pmaports import pmb.parse.apkindex from pmb.core import Chroot from pmb.core.context import get_context def package_provider( pkgname: str, pkgnames_install: list[str], suffix: Chroot = Chroot.native() ) -> pmb.core.apkindex_block.ApkindexBlock | None: """ :param pkgnames_install: packages to be installed :returns: ApkindexBlock object or None (no provider found) """ # Get all providers arch = suffix.arch providers = pmb.parse.apkindex.providers(pkgname, arch, False) # 0. No provider if len(providers) == 0: return None # 1. Only one provider logging.verbose(f"{pkgname}: provided by: {', '.join(providers)}") if len(providers) == 1: return list(providers.values())[0] # 2. Provider with the same package name if pkgname in providers: logging.verbose(f"{pkgname}: choosing package of the same name as " "provider") return providers[pkgname] # 3. Pick a package that will be installed anyway for provider_pkgname, provider in providers.items(): if provider_pkgname in pkgnames_install: logging.verbose( f"{pkgname}: choosing provider '{provider_pkgname}" "', because it will be installed anyway" ) return provider # 4. Pick a package that is already installed installed = pmb.chroot.apk.installed(suffix) for provider_pkgname, provider in providers.items(): if provider_pkgname in installed: logging.verbose( f"{pkgname}: choosing provider '{provider_pkgname}" f"', because it is installed in the '{suffix}' " "chroot already" ) return provider # 5. Pick an explicitly selected provider provider_pkgname = get_context().config.providers.get(pkgname, "") if provider_pkgname in providers: logging.verbose( f"{pkgname}: choosing provider '{provider_pkgname}', " "because it was explicitly selected." ) return providers[provider_pkgname] # 6. Pick the provider(s) with the highest priority providers = pmb.parse.apkindex.provider_highest_priority(providers, pkgname) if len(providers) == 1: return list(providers.values())[0] # 7. Pick the shortest provider. (Note: Normally apk would fail here!) return pmb.parse.apkindex.provider_shortest(providers, pkgname)
